Good Morning Girls!  Yesterday I introduced a new topic that is stirring in my heart.  It is the importance of our words.  There are many different areas to consider when talking about our words.  They are the words spoken to our spouses, kids, friends, acquaintances,  strangers, and ourselves.  The Lord has little "assignments" for us in all of these areas.   I encourage you right now to determine to do these assignments with a good attitude and an expectation for good things to happen.  I do believe we will be hearing some awesome testimonies come out of this!  Are you ready?  Are you willing?  Most importantly.....are you able?
Well according tot the word, we are all able (though at times it doesn't feel like it).  We are all able to speak blessing not cursing because it says in Galatians 5:23 that we are given a spirit of self control.  That means that despite our fleshly desires to rip into our husbands when they don't do what we want them to, we do have the ability to speak to them gently and try to explain to them what it is we want or need.  I know.....this may seem unbelievable....but the Word says it, so it must be true.  We have this crazy thing called self control!
God knew we would struggle with our words.  The Word is filled with scriptures warning us about the dangers of idle, foolish, and destructive talk.  He talks about the need to bridle the tongue.  He also tells us what we should use our words for.  We will be looking at all of these things over the next few days (or possibly weeks....this could take awhile).
Let's start out slow.  Baby steps.  One day at a time.  Today we are going to speak encouragement to ourselves that we can in fact speak words of blessing.  Every time you walk by a mirror, or are driving in your car I want you to say the following confessions.  Yes, it is a little like Stuart Smalley on Saturday Night Live.....but it works!

I am anointed to speak words of blessing and encouragement to myself and others, to a level the world is unfamiliar with, all to the glory of God! 

"I will watch what I do and not sin in what I say"-Psalm 39:1
